Great, serene spot
We had a wonderful stay at Camp SourBerry.
The single campsite was private and quiet, very relaxing. Chelsea gave detailed directions—including a really helpful video—and while the property is large and secluded, it’s also close to town—the best of all worlds. We enjoyed walking around and taking in the views, and I loved meeting the sheep, dogs, and turkeys. (We also saw wild geese.) The animals are over the hill from the campsite, out of sight, and we went only on invitation—it’s easy to keep to yourself if you prefer.
The wood chips in the pull through area were great for our camper van—made it easy to park, and minimized dust and mess. Very thoughtful layout.
All in all, we couldn’t have asked for a more relaxing place to spend the night. We had a wonderful evening and a leisurely, peaceful morning. A beautiful spot, and such a great break from the city—we didn’t want to leave!

Our family stayed for one night while traveling from out of state with our 2-year-old daughter. We selected this location because it was a pull-through site in a convenient location along our route and we were looking for something more secluded than larger campground options. Unfortunately, when we arrived, there was a large pile of wood chips blocking the path so the site was not pull-through - not a major problem but having to coordinate backing in on a slope just as it was starting to rain after a long day of traveling was not ideal. Regarding privacy, the site is right next to a gate with a security camera that rotates (and seems to track as you walk by) so, while we were not physically next to any other people, we did not feel very secluded. Overall, a nice setting that met our needs for one night but would not stay again.
